Murdoch to launch Sun on Sunday this week

LONDON -- Rupert Murdoch's new Sun on Sunday will bow Feb. 26 -- and for Murdoch that day can't come too soon. The tycoon plans to remain in London to supervise the launch of a paper that has been in the cards ever since News Corp. shuttered the News of the World last July, when the phone-hacking scandal went toxic. Announcing the launch date, News International's CEO Tom Mockridge hailed the move "as a truly historic moment in newspaper publishing." In his statement, Mockridge added that News Corp. "has made clear its determination to sort out what has gone wrong in the past and we are fundamentally changing how we operate as a business." Commentators were divided on the wisdom of launching a Sunday edition of the Sun when the U.K. newspaper biz is in decline and the phone hacking and police corruption scandal shows no sign of ending. But in the avowedly anti-Murdoch Guardian Roy Greenslade, a one-time assistant editor on the Sun, saw next Sunday's debut as proof that Rupert Murdoch has finally rediscovered his old, buccaneering self. Greenslade wrote, "This astonishing initiative is all about one angry man, having suffered a setback that looked as if it might end in him sacrificing his British media interests, striking back to save his empire. "It's personal, not corporate. "He wants to show his staff, the politicians, the rest of Fleet Street, the readers, News Corp.'s investors -- indeed, the world -- that he will not go quietly." Other media sages have been more skeptical. The Guardian's former editor Peter Preston, writing in the Observer, said a Sunday Sun could backfire if more journos at the paper are arrested on allegations of bribing public officials, or if charges are eventually brought against any of the 10 arrested to date. It remains to be seen if the Sun on Sunday -- or SOS as it's been nicknamed -- is a hit with U.K. readers, many of whom stopped buying a Sunday newspaper when the News of the World closed. British Film Institute poised to get more coin

LONDON -- The British Film Institute could be set for a dramatic increase in its funding, thanks to a boom in sales of National Lottery tickets, according to the latest U.K. government estimates. Culture minister Ed Vaizey announced that the BFI is now projected to receive 240 million ($380 million) in lottery coin from 2012-13 to 2016-17, up 20% from the previous predicted figure of around $318 million. That would translate as an average budget of $78 million a year to be spent on U.K. film production, distribution, training and industry development. The government previously said the BFI's lottery funding would increase from $43 million to $68 million a year by 2014. That compares to the budget of $40 million a year received by the U.K. Film Council before its closure last April. But insiders estimate that the BFI's actual budget could even higher, to as much as $90 million a year, after including unspent surpluses inherited from the UKFC and recoupment revenues from hit UKFC films such as "The King's Speech" and "Streetdance 3D." The BFI was already set to benefit from the government's decision to give a larger share of the national lottery revenues to the arts from 2012 onward, after several years in which a significant proportion of lottery coin was diverted to funding the London 2012 Olympics. The latest increased budget estimates follow an unexpected rise in lottery ticket sales. The Arts Council of England is also now projected to receive an extra $253 million from 2012 to 2017, bringing its total five-year budget to $1.98 billion. But Vaizey cautioned that these increases will only materialize if the current upward trend of lottery sales continues over the next five years. "In a time of economic uncertainty, the arts are more important than ever," Vaizey said. "The cultural value is immeasurable and we are in no doubt about the contribution that the arts make to our economy, our communities, our schools and our well-being. "We reformed the National Lottery so that the arts, film, sports and heritage would all benefit. And rising ticket sales mean that an extra 200 million could be going to the arts over the next five years, which is great news for artists and audiences across the country." Tenpercenter Carlos Carreras joins APA

Talent agent Carlos Carreras has joined APA after ankling from Paradigm. Carreras will report to Ryan Martin, head of the agency's Talent Department. Carreras' client roster has a wide variety of Latin American talent including Demian Bichir, Karen Olivo and Ana Claudia Talancon. Other clients include Jose Maria Yazpik, Jordi Molla, Leonardo Sbaraglia, William Fichtner, Gina Rodriguez, Derek Theler, Diego Klattenhoff, Ashley Zukerman, Jason Priestley, Harrison Gilbertson, Oscar Jaenada and Jordi Molla. It's unclear which clients will follow his move to APA. Carreras previously worked as an agent at UTA for five years, expanding representation in the Spanish-language marketplace with Jennifer Lopez, Jimmy Smits, Ruben Blades and Wilmer Valderrama and Guillermo Arriaga. Ramsey cast in CW's 'Arrow' pilot

RamseyDavid Ramsey has been cast in the CW pilot "Arrow." Thesp, who is currently recurring in CBS' "Blue Bloods" as the mayor of NY, will play the character John Diggle, a former military man now working as a bodyguard for hire who soon finds he is trapped in a battle of wits, loyalty and trust. Stephen Amell was previously cast for the lead role of Oliver Queen. "Arrow," which is based on the DC Comics book "Green Arrow," is being produced by Warner Bros. Television and Berlanti Prods. Greg Berlanti is writing and exec producing with Marc Guggenheim and Andrew Kreisberg. David Nutter is directing the pilot and also receives exec producer credit. Ramsey has previously appeared in "Dexter" and "Ghost Whisperer." He is repped by APA, Principato-Young and Stone, Meyer, Genow, Smelkinson & Binder.
